Alan M. Parker (born 31 March 1939)[1] is a British billionaire businessman.
Alan M. Parker[2] was born into a family in Rhodesia (now Zimbabwe), the son of a British colonial civil servant.
[3] Parker trained as an accountant, and worked for the Hong Kong–based DFS Group.
He became DFS's third largest shareholder, and in 1997 when it was taken over by LVMH, Parker received about $840m (£464m) for his 20% stake.
[1][2] Parker also made money investing in hedge funds and high technology.
